All of the many types of grinding machines use a grinding wheel made from one of the manufactured abrasives, silicon carbide or aluminum oxide. The wheel is manufactured by mixing selected sizes of abrasive granules with a bonding agent (such as clay, resin, rubber, shellac, or .

Nov 17, 2014· The grinding plate, also called a cutting plate, is a round carbon or stainless steel plate with several holes in it that sits at the end of the meat grinder. As meat is forced through the holes of the grinding plate, a spinning blade cuts across the holes several times per second.

A drill is a tool primarily used for making round holes or driving fasteners. It is fitted with a bit, either a drill or driver, depending on application, secured by a powered drills also include a hammer function.. Drills vary widely in speed, power, and size. (a) General requirements (1) Machine guarding. Abrasive wheels shall be used only on machines provided with safety guards as defined in the following paragraphs of this section, except: (i) Wheels used for internal work while within the work being ground; (ii) Mounted wheels, used in portable operations, 2 inches and smaller in diameter; and (iii) Types 16, 17, 18, 18R, and 19 cones, plugs ...
Technical Support. For machine reaming, .010" on a ¼" hole, .015" on a ½" hole, up to .025" on a 1 ½" hole, seems a good s starting point. For hand reaming, stoke allowances are much smaller, partly because of the d difficulty in forcing the reamer through greater stock. .
